Before starting the treatment, we must know seminal parameters for male partner & Tubal Status, Ovulation Status and Hormonal Profile of female partner. This helps us to decide the most cost effective line of management.

Traditionally, in our society the blame of childlessness is always on wife. It is not true. Both Husband and Wife are responsible for making a baby so problem could be in either of partner or both. In Males, cause may be less number of sperm & poor quality sperm or nil sperms while in females, main reason are deficient egg formation, hormonal disturbances, blocked tube, endometriosis, Tuberculosis and other infections. 15 – 20% of couples may show no obvious cause but are unable have a baby on there own.

Normally fertilization & early development takes place in fallopian tubes. In IVF or Test Tube Bay, egg are taken out by ultrasound in a test tube and then fertilized with husband’s sperm in IVF lab. Initial development for 2 – 3 day also occur outside than growing embryo is transferred back in uterus. Rest of the development takes place as in normal pregnancy. If a couple is unable to have a baby in spite of one year of unprotected sexual contact, they should consult a qualified infertility specialist / gynecologist. Suppose a couple is not able to conceive in 6 months of trying/ unprotected sex they need not go for infertility treatment.
